How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Liberty Ridge?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Liberty Ridge Studio Apartments | $1,557 | $1,210 | $1,934 |
| Liberty Ridge 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,862 | $1,050 | $2,856 |
| Liberty Ridge 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,326 | $1,595 | $3,937 |
Liberty Ridge 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,892 | $1,968 | $4,440 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Liberty Ridge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Liberty Ridge with 3 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in Liberty Ridge is at The Windsor listed at $2,406.
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Liberty Ridge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Liberty Ridge is $2,892.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Liberty Ridge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Liberty Ridge is a 1,943 square feet unit starting from $4,237 at Pinnacle on Lake Washington.
What is the average size for Liberty Ridge 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Liberty Ridge is currently 1,370 sq ft.
